- Changed `proxy` package function signature to [support structured logger](https://github.com/etcd-io/etcd/pull/11614).
- Previously, `NewClusterProxy(c *clientv3.Client, advaddr string, prefix string) (pb.ClusterServer, <-chan struct{})`, now `NewClusterProxy(lg *zap.Logger, c *clientv3.Client, advaddr string, prefix string) (pb.ClusterServer, <-chan struct{})`.
- Previously, `Register(c *clientv3.Client, prefix string, addr string, ttl int)`, now `Register(lg *zap.Logger, c *clientv3.Client, prefix string, addr string, ttl int) <-chan struct{}`.
- Previously, `NewHandler(t *http.Transport, urlsFunc GetProxyURLs, failureWait time.Duration, refreshInterval time.Duration) http.Handler`, now `NewHandler(lg *zap.Logger, t *http.Transport, urlsFunc GetProxyURLs, failureWait time.Duration, refreshInterval time.Duration) http.Handler`.
